Ithaca Calendar Clock Co. "Index" Shelf Clock for the Lynch Brothers
late 19th century
walnut case, 8-day time and strike movement with half deadbeat escapement, lower dial marked "Manufactured for Lynch Brothers," movement marked "E.N. Welch Clock Co., Made for the Ithaca Cal. Clock Co."
31 1/2 x 14 3/4 x 5 1/2 inches
Provenance: The Paul VanDemark Collection, Delmar, New York

Condition
Rubbed down finish, retains the original glass, dials, calendar rolls and hands, functions properly (15-minute test), calendar advances properly.
